1 Chronicles 12:2

נֹשְׁקֵ֣י קֶ֔שֶׁת מַיְמִינִ֥ים וּמַשְׂמִאלִ֖ים בָּאֲבָנִ֑ים וּבַחִצִּ֣ים בַּקָּ֑שֶׁת מֵאֲחֵ֥י שָׁא֖וּל מִבִּנְיָמִֽן׃
noshqey qeshet maymiyniym vmashmiʾliym baʾabaniym vbaḥiṣiym baqashet meʾaḥey shaʾvl mibinyamin
King James Version (KJV)

They were armed with bows, and could use both the right hand and the left in hurling stones and shooting arrows out of a bow, even of Saul's brethren of Benjamin.

Modern English

They were bowmen and could shoot arrows and sling stones with either the right or the left hand; they were Benjaminites, Saul's kinsmen.
